Through its site on the Loire River, Saint-Jean-Saint-Maurice offers a view of the reservoir reservoir of Villerest built in 1982. The lake that has been created over 30 km makes the joy of fishing and boating enthusiasts. At the foot of Saint-Maurice village, the harbour of La Quail offers 80 mooring points.Saint-Maurice retains many traces of its past: town of Jœuvres (on the other side of the Loire), the th century dungeon in the ruins of the castle, the town gate and ramparts, ancient houses, church with frescoes of the th century entirely covered by th century murals, including a fresco of St. Jacques in pilgrim attesting that Saint Maurice was on the path to Santiago, as well as the legends of Saint Nicholas and Saint Maurice, scenes of Genesis and the Nativity (sorted MH). The tower of the solar dial (1604) and the manor of La Mure-Chantois, current town hall, decorated with delicate limestone sculptures especially on the turret. Saint John is built around a former Benedictine priory of the 1874 th century whose only testimony consists of a tower tower, built in the reconstructed church in. It contains statues of the Virgin and Saint John, works by the Forézien artist Bonassieux.
